Overview Srota 50mg Tablet
Deplin 50mg tablets are sel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s), a class of antidepressants. Prescribed for depression and anxiety disorders such as obsessive-compulsive disorder and panic attacks, Deplin 50mg may also treat premenstrual dysphoric disorder (PMDD). Administration is independent of food intake; dosage and frequency are determined by your physician to optimize symptom management. Your doctor might begin with a lower dose, gradually increasing it. Never adjust or discontinue use without consulting your doctor; abrupt cessation can worsen your condition or trigger withdrawal (e.g., anxiety, agitation, rapid heartbeat, dizziness, sleep problems). For best results, take consistently at the same time daily—morning administration is advised if sleep disturbances occur. Significant improvement may take several weeks; inform your physician if no improvement is seen after a month. Common side effects include nausea, dyspepsia, appetite changes, hyperhidrosis, tremors, insomnia, and diarrhea. Reduced libido, delayed ejaculation, and erectile dysfunction are also possible. Report immediate worsening of mood or suicidal thoughts to your doctor. Before starting Deplin 50mg, disclose any epilepsy, diabetes, hepatic or renal impairment, cardiac issues, or glaucoma, as these could impact treatment.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ical counsel prior to use. Interactions may occur with other medications, particularly other antidepressants and MAO inhibitors; provide your physician with a complete medication list to ensure safety.

How Srota 50mg Tablet works:
Seroquel 50mg tablets function as a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I), a type of antidepressant medication. Its mechanism involves elevating serotonin, a neurotransmitter, within the brain. This action alleviates depressive symptoms, both emotional and physical, and also provides relief from obsessive-compulsive disorder, panic attacks, premenstrual dysphoric disorder, and anxiety.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Concurrent use of Srota 50mg tablets and alcohol may result in increased sleepiness.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Srota 50m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Administration of Srota 50m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Srota 50mg T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Srota 50mg tablets pose no safety concerns for individuals with kidney impairment; dosage modification isn't typically necessary. Nevertheless, disclose any pre-existing kidney conditions to your physician, as a lower starting dose with gradual increases may be considered.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Srota 50m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Srota 50mg t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severe hepatic dysfunction.
What if you forget to take Srota 50m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Srota 50mg Tablet dose,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
